Release checklist — Shrinkray CLI v2.4 (batch image resizing). Before you cut the release, run the golden-set resize against the fixtures bucket and eyeball the three worst-case panoramas; the new lanczos path has bitten us before. Confirm memory stays under 1.5 GB on the 10k-image batch, and that exit codes match the docs (0, 2, 7 only). If anything looks off, ping whoever's on-call for Toolsmiths rather than shipping anyway. Once it's green, tag the artifact with the token below.

pipeline stamp: htk31_f769b577b3028a4e9958e5bb8d1259a

**Q: Are the lifts running this weekend?** No. Both lifts in the Halloway Annexe are down for winch maintenance Saturday 06:00 to Sunday 18:00. Direct staff to the east stairwell. Goods deliveries should be deferred or rerouted via the Penfold loading dock. Contractors from Bray Vertical Systems will be on site; they sign in at the facilities desk as normal. The stairwell door locks after 19:00, so anyone working late will need the weekend access code. Issue it only to rostered staff. The code is below.

badge for bawef-bahap: bdg-LALUM-4

## Snapshot test verification — Lanternfold UI kit

Snapshot runs for the Lanternfold component library execute in an isolated runner with no network egress except the baseline store. Each run compares rendered output against signed baselines; any diff blocks the merge until a reviewer approves the updated snapshot. Baselines are immutable once published, so tampering is detectable by hash mismatch. The runner fetches baselines from the Quillhaven artifact store, and the line immediately below this comment sets the token it presents.

sealed setting: ARCHIVE_KEY3=8d0